Roma want Soldado

Another suitor has emerged for Roberto Soldado, Italian side Roma.

Roma want Soldado


Having joined Tottenham for £26 million last summer Soldado has had a miserable season initially in a system where he wasn't given the ball. It is hardly any wonder that he became frustrated and the pressure grew on him.

Tottenham are said to be willing to let him leave for £20 million but clubs will naturally be hoping to pick up a bargain. The Spanish international has allegedly having told his agent to get him out of White Hart Lane even if it means a big pay cut. A drop in wages would simply take him back to the wages he had at Valencia so that is not as big a deal as it would be for other players.

Having studies Pochettino's system I am not convinced that it would suit Soldado despite him clearly being a quality finisher. We may not get the chance to find out.

Roma were interested in him when he was at Valencia but his price tag put them off, now they sense a bargain sources reveal.

"The player's re-sale value has obviously dropped due to a poor season by his standards. However, Roma were were keen on him when he was at Valencia and nothing has changed their mind."
